And one of the great Punahou traditions is the 25th Reunion Class Gift. This gives us the opportunity to "give back" to a school that provided us with a solid educational foundation, opportunities to form lasting relationships, and many memories (some fond, some not-so-fond!).
For our 25th Reunion class gift, we have pledged our support to the new Case Middle School currently under construction. This extraordinary project is the culmination of extensive research and investigation on educational models, adolescent development, learning concepts and design and construction techniques. It will provide the 6th, 7th and 8th graders with an evolutionary new learning environment designed to develop all academic, cultural and social facets of middle school students.
So, we're asking each of you to consider making a pledge towards our 25th Reunion Class Gift which, as mentioned, will go to supporting the new Case Middle School.
We have set two goals for our class. First, 100 percent participation. This has never been done before. The highest class participation was 80 percent but we think we can do better. Secondly, we would also like to break the record set last year by the class of '78 of $175,270 so we've set our goal at $179,000. We think we can attain both but we really need your help.
